Factors Affecting Installation Time

Before diving into specific timeframes, it's essential to understand  Driveway Installation Services  the factors that influence how long driveway installation might take.

  1. Type of Material: Different materials, such as concrete, asphalt, gravel, or pavers, have varying installation times. For instance, asphalt driveways generally take less time to install compared to concrete due to the curing process involved.

  2. Size of the Driveway: Naturally, a larger driveway will require more time for installation than a smaller one. The excavation, preparation, and installation processes scale with the size of the area.

  3. Weather Conditions: Weather plays a crucial role in driveway installation. Rainy or extremely cold conditions can delay the process as they affect the curing and setting times for many driveway materials.


Typical Timeframes for Driveway Installation

  • Asphalt Driveway: An asphalt driveway is one of the quicker options for installation. Typically, the process can be completed in about 1 to 3 days. This includes excavation, laying the base, compacting, and finally, laying the asphalt. However, it's worth noting that asphalt needs time to cure before it can be used, usually around 24 to 48 hours.

  • Concrete Driveway: Concrete driveways are durable but require more time to install due to the curing process. On average, a concrete driveway installation in Nashville can take anywhere from 4 to 7 days. This duration includes excavation, laying the base, pouring and leveling the concrete, and allowing it to cure for several days.

  • Gravel Driveway: Gravel driveways are relatively quick to install, often completed within 1 to 2 days. The process involves grading the area, laying the gravel, and compacting it. Gravel driveways are also flexible and can be easily modified or expanded.

  • Paver Driveway: Paver driveways are versatile and aesthetically pleasing but can be more time-consuming to install. Depending on the complexity of the design and size, paver driveway installation can take anywhere from 5 to 10 days. This duration includes excavation, laying the base, laying the pavers, and filling the joints with sand.


Additional Considerations

While these are general timeframes, it's crucial to account for additional factors that might extend the installation process:

  • Permitting and Approval: Before starting the installation, you may need to obtain permits or approvals from local authorities. This process can add a few days to the overall timeline.

  • Preparation Work: Sometimes, existing driveways or landscaping might need to be removed or modified before installing the new driveway. This can add to the time and labor required for the project.

  • Custom Features: If you're adding custom features like decorative borders, lighting, or drainage systems, these will also increase the installation time.
